Understanding Anxiety and Sorrow

Understanding Grief - Image - On Your Mind Counselling

One of the worst aspects of loss is that there is no chance to prepare for it.

Nobody forewarns you for the turbulent sea of feelings that follow, both emotional and physical. It's a struggle to breathe, to be present, and to find a sense of normalcy. It's as if everything in your life has actually become unimportant compared to the extreme pain of the loss you're presently dealing with.

The world loses its colour, joy becomes a far-off memory, and every element of life is overshadowed by the haunting space left by your child's absence.

It is essential to mention that through the discomfort of loss and grief, grief is a natural response to loss.

Dealing with the loss of your child can evoke a range of extreme reactions, ideas and feelings - from extreme unhappiness to anger, frustrating feelings of regret to profound emptiness.

Bereavement is not restricted to a psychological reaction alone. Grieving the loss of your child can likewise stimulate a physical reaction, including modifications in weight or hunger, problems sleeping, muscle pains, and impaired immune actions, which can impact our health in substantial ways. This is where grief counselling in Deseronto after the loss of your child can assist.

The expression of our feelings or behaviours typically represents the stage of grief and loss we are in. In no specific order, when we experience grief, the stages of sorrow include:

  • Denial: acting as a defence mechanism to protect us versus overwhelming feelings, denial includes the refusal to accept the reality (or seriousness) of the loss
  • Anger: once the disastrous reality of the loss sets in, anger often becomes the primary defence, which may be directed inwardly towards ourselves, towards others, or perhaps to your child
  • Bargaining: there might come a time when we attempt to work out or haggle with a higher power or ourselves as a way to return in time, reverse the catastrophe, or reduce the devastation we are experiencing
  • Depression: feelings of intense sadness, solitude, and despair prevail in the experience of grief, triggering people to withdraw from others and battle with feelings of hopelessness
  • Acceptance: it requires time, however the truth of our loss can become much easier to grapple with, permitting us to get used to a new normal without our child in the physical world

Moving through the stages of each type of sorrow experience typically occurs in a non-linear method. It's also possible to avoid stages, move back and forth in between phases, and even reach acceptance but still enable symptoms of sorrow, anger, or depression to embed down the road.

Cognitive Behavioural Therapy

Usually, our counsellors make use of Cognitive Behaviour Therapy (CBT), which assists people who are coping with sorrow, as it focuses on determining and challenging negative thought patterns or behaviours that accompany sensations of grief.

From a trauma-informed lens, CBT counselling can assist people acknowledge and customize certain unfavourable ideas, such as guilt or self-blame, in an effort to develop healthier coping methods. This method is essential for building strength and permitting the steady adjustment to life without your child.

Acceptance and Commitment Therapy

Acceptance and Commitment Therapy (ACT) is another important approach that focuses on accepting hard emotions connected with grief. Instead of forcing ourselves to remove or suppress these feelings, ACT motivates us to mindfully engage with them within a safe and nonjudgmental restorative environment. It guides us to live authentically and make choices that line up with our values.

Usually, our counsellors make use of ACT to promote mental versatility, placing us in the driver's seat of our pain and permitting us to adjust to the changes of our loss while likewise discovering purpose and satisfaction in life.

Emotion-Focused Therapy

As we understand, feelings are at the forefront of our grieving process. They exist whether we try to reveal, transform, or reduce them. Emotion-Focused Therapy (EFT) concentrates on helping us end up being more knowledgeable about our emotions, find out how to express them safely, and transform specific maladaptive or troublesome psychological actions into healthier ones.

Our trauma-informed counsellors utilize EFT as the structure for exploring and making sense of the emotional effect of our sorrow. Collaborating, we can establish psychological policy skills essential for coping and recovery.

Narrative Therapy

During grief counselling in Deseronto after the loss of your child, narrative therapy concentrates on the stories we tell about our experiences. It helps us understand grief and work through the pain by externalizing it. In other words, narrative therapy enables us to view our sorrow as a separate entity rather than a part of our identity.

Our counsellors utilize narrative therapy to help us reconstruct or reinterpret our sorrow stories, stressing our own strengths, durability, and agency. This method can offer us a way to find significance, develop a more empowered narrative of our stories, and use a path towards healing.
